Graduate school can further study, have more room for development in academia or research field, and gain more professional knowledge and skills. At the same time, the learning environment of graduate students is relatively more free, and they can have more time and opportunities to expand and grow themselves.
Work can be fast and independent, economically self-sufficient, and it is easier to adapt to the fast-paced life of modern cities. In addition, work can also allow you to accumulate experience and establish a social network in the workplace, which has a comparative advantage for your future career development.
Studying abroad can provide a broader international vision, language environment and cultural exchange opportunities, especially for students in some professional fields, studying abroad is also an essential choice. At the same time, studying abroad can also bring more opportunities and challenges, and strengthen self-learning and adaptability.
In short, the three options of further education, employment and going abroad have their own advantages and disadvantages. It is very important to choose the direction that suits your own situation and development needs.
